Why Price Doesn't Dictate Safety
When shopping for baby furnishings, security ought to always be the primary priority. Numerous moms and dads worry that purchasing a more affordable cot means cutting corners on security.
The comforting truth is that all cots sold on the market needs to satisfy strict safety policies, despite just how much they cost. Whether a cot expenses ₤ 100 or ₤ 1,000, it needs to legally abide by nationwide and international safety requirements relating to slat spacing, structural stability, non-toxic finishes, and bed mattress firmness.

Key Features to Look for in a Budget Cot
When browsing budget friendly cots, moms and dads need to keep a checklist of essential features to guarantee they are getting the finest value for their cash.
- Adjustable Mattress Heights: Look for a cot with multiple mattress levels. A higher setting is essential for babies so parents do not strain their backs, while a lower setting avoids young children from climbing up out as they grow.
- Repaired Sides: Modern security requirements strongly favor fixed-side cots over drop-side models, which are prone to mechanical failure over time. Fixed sides are safer and normally more affordable to manufacture.
- Teething Rails: Plastic or smooth protective strips along the top ranked cribs edges of the rails avoid children from gnawing on the wood and protect the surface of the cot.
- Non-Toxic Finishes: Babies like to chew and suck on everything in sight. Make sure the cot utilizes baby-safe, non-toxic paints and varnishes free of lead and hazardous VOCs.
- Tough Construction: Check that the frame is made of durable wood (such as pine) or metal, and prevent overly lightweight models that wobble.

Beyond selecting an entry-level model, savvy moms and dads can use numerous strategies to stretch their nursery budget further:
- Buy a Mattress Separately (Wisely): Many budget cots do not include a bed mattress. While it can be appealing to purchase the least expensive mattress offered, purchase a firm, breathable mattress that fits snugly inside the cot without any spaces. A good bed mattress ensures better sleep and safety.
- Look for Multi-Functional Furniture: A cot that transforms into a toddler bed or daybed removes the need to buy another bed when your child outgrows the infant stage.
- Shop End-of-Season Sales: Major holiday weekends (like Black Friday, Memorial Day, or Labor Day) typically feature high discount rates on baby furnishings.
- Consider Second-Hand (With Caution): Buying a used cot can conserve a lot of money, however just if it fulfills existing safety standards. Prevent drop-side cots, examine that no parts are missing out on, make sure the slat range is safe (usually no more than 2-3/8 inches apart), and constantly purchase a new mattress for hygiene and security reasons.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are cheap cots safe for newborns?
Yes. As long as the cot adheres to official safety standards (such as ASTM, CPSC, or EN standards), an affordable cot is simply as safe as an expensive designer model. Constantly look for accreditation labels before acquiring.
2. Should I buy a cot with wheels?
Wheels (casters) can be practical if you prepare to move the cot in between spaces throughout the day. Nevertheless, ensure that the wheels have trusted locking mechanisms so the cot stays entirely stationary when the cheap baby cots for sale is sleeping.
3. Do economical cots featured a mattress?
Most budget friendly cots do not consist of a mattress. Parents need to always budget plan an additional ₤ 40 to ₤ 100 for a company, high-quality, effectively fitting bed mattress designed specifically for the cot model.
4. How long can a baby sleep in a standard cot?
Most babies can easily sleep in a basic cot from birth up until they are about 2 to 3 years of ages, or until they reach a height where they can easily climb up over the rails.
5. What is the best paint finish to try to find?
Look for cots ended up with water-based, non-toxic paints or natural wood oils. These finishes do not give off damaging chemical fumes and are safe if the baby takes place to mouth the rails.
